Landed Property, &c, For Sale.

FOR IMMEDIATE SALE, TWO Fine ESTATES at Whangarei, province of Auckland, New Zealand. Lot 1, containing about 4,000 acres at MANGA WAI, with a large and INEXHAUSTIBLE QUANTITY of FLAX, ready for cutting, and about 500 ' acres of rich English grass ; the whole comprising the most fertile and best land in New Zealand ; close to water communication. Lot 2, containing 8,000 acres, at RUAKAKA, near Whangarei Heads, of good land for grazing purposes or flax-growing, with a handsome Family Residence ; is one of the most healthy localities in New Zealand, and within four hours' sail of Auckland. For full particulars and terms, apply to JOSEPH NEWMAN, Land Agent.

FOR SALE, A SAW-MILL on the Wairoa River, Kaipara.: CUTS 10,000 feet per day, is in First-rate* Working order, and has a large SUPPLY of TIMBER in the Bush, which can be got to the Mill at all times, independent of floods. For full particulars, apply to BROWN, CAMPBELL, & CO. Auckland, May 17, 1870.

TO BE SOLD, rpHAT COMMODIODS and WELLJ. BUILT HOUSE known as the residence of the late William Hobson, j Esq. The House and Garden occupy two large Allotments, with a frontage of 120 feet to the best part of Hobson-street, On the property is a First-class Stable and Coach-house, recently erected at great expense. The House throughout is fitted "in a. superior manner. There is a Large Kitchen Range, Bath»room, fee, and a Splendid Well of Water. The Grazing on the adjoining land may be let to the purchasei of the above property. For f virther'particulars, apply to * A W..J. CAWKWELL, f , Vulcan-lane..
